Lenape PTO, parents spearhead graduation gift bags for Class of ’20

Donation drive seeks merchandise, funds for graduating seniors

Lenape High School’s LED sign after adopting remote learning as a response to the COVID-19 pandemic. (Krystal Nurse/The Sun).

Calling all Lenape High School families, Lenape alumni, the Lenape-Mount Laurel community, friends and family: Let’s show the upcoming graduates of the Lenape High School’s Class of 2020 our support!

The PTO and parents are putting together a special graduation gift bag full of merchandise and gift cards for each and every senior.

- Advertisement -

No Disney trip, no prom, no senior spring sports, no senior recognition awards, no senior community service day, no Project Graduation — and now the reality of a virtual graduation. The Class of 2020 seniors will not have those special moments that give them closure on the high-school chapter of their life.

But you can do a little something extra to create a uniquely happy memory for them by helping in a couple different ways.
